ATP 3-09.23 covers radar employment, fire mission processing, counterfire, tactical fire control, specialized operations, and battalion mission products. It requires synchronized sustainment planning and establishes responsibilities for radar zone management and fire direction.
The FDO supervises tactical and technical fire direction within the battalion. (paragraph 1-99)
The FA battalion commander is ultimately responsible for counterfire and zone management. (paragraph 4-31)
Automated systems digitally link the FA battalion internally and externally with supported higher HQ, subordinate agencies, and adjacent units. (paragraph 5-20)
Sustainment planning must focus on tasks and systems that provide support and services to the battalion's Soldiers and weapon systems. Sustainment planning must address sustainment support during phases of an operation. (paragraph 7-108)
Companies and platoons will continue to need high volumes of smoke and suppressive fires in close combat engagements. (paragraph 6-3)
